Organic products are healthcare products intended to the avoidance, cure or heal of the condition issue in human beings or animals; and Also they are utilised to circumvent or diagnose diseases. Quite a few biological products are produced from a variety of purely natural resources that features individuals, animals, plants and microorganisms. Typical samples of biological products contain: vaccines, human insulin, monoclonal antibodies, blood and blood products for transfusion and/or production into other products, allergenic extracts (which can be used for the two analysis and treatment of allergic conditions), human cells and tissues useful for transplantation, gene therapy products, mobile therapy products and exam kits to display screen opportunity blood donors for infectious agents like human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) (Figure 1).

Sampling is described since the statistical procedure of selecting a part or percentage of a whole product or service batch to represent the entire batch. And samples are picked or picked in a random manner to serve as representative samples of the whole good deal. The usage of membrane filtration method and direct inoculation applying lifestyle (nutrient) media are often the two most crucial principal sterility testing strategy applied to find out the sterility of an item.
